Two Chinese companies to invest EUR 48 million in Serbia

BELGRADE - A memorandum of understanding with the Chinese company Meita Group concerning an investment into the construction of a factory in Obrenovac and with Streit Group, also from China, about an expansion of a plant in Stara Pazova was signed at the Serbian government headquartes on Friday, with a combined value of EUR 48 million.

The Obrenovac investment is worth more than EUR 30 million and the one in Stara Pazova around EUR 18 million and they are expected to create more than 1,400 jobs.

The memorandum was signed by Serbia's Ministry of Economy Zeljko Sertic, Meita Group CEO Ben Che, Streit Group Executive Director Remy Barthelme and mayors of Belgrade Sinisa Mali, Obrenovac Miroslav Cuckovic and Stara Pazova Djordje Radinovic.
